When: 7.30pm on Thursday 18 June 2009
Where: Mint Lounge, 46 Oldham Street, Manchester M4 1LE

Acoustic Ladyland have been a fantastic force for change on the British jazz scene, not least because they don’t play anything recognisably jazzy. The band, who formed through their ‘mutual distaste for jazz sterility and respect for Jimi Hendrix’, have gone from strength to strength with their most recent albums Last Chance Disco and Skinny Grin receiving critical acclaim and public success.

Local support from the Chris Illingworth Trio and Gnod.

This very exciting evening will be a co-promotion with the Freedom Principle.
